Online communication security

The oversimplified version of electronic communication privacy:

  • iPhone users: Conversations in blue bubbles are secure, while messages in green bubbles to non-iPhone devices are not secure.
  • Use Signal or What’s App. What’s App is owned by Meta that keeps backups of date and might be subject to breech or to cooperate with governments requests, and that raises concerns.
  • It is safest to presume that your regular cell voice calls, call logs, email and social media accounts have already been hacked, or may be hacked, and the AI technology to analyze them and extract data exists.
  • If your CPA or other financial adviser uses secure portal system, confirm the details but this is highly secure but subject to court-ordered subpoena of data. An attorney’s secure portal is not likely subject to subpoena.
